The
number of shoppers frequenting discount stores has not
fallen below 88 percent since April of 2004
More than 88 percent of American
shoppers made purchases in discount stores during April, ranking
discount stores as the most popular retail store in the nation.
The findings came from the Consumer Mind Reader ™ survey, a
national research survey conducted every two months by
America’s
Research Group. Based in Charleston, South Carolina, ARG
conducts survey research projects for retailers and
manufacturers across the country.
"Discount stores see more shoppers than any other retail
category in America," said Britt Beemer, founder and chairman of
America’s Research Group. Beemer noted that the number of
shoppers frequenting discount stores has not fallen below 88
percent since April of 2004.
"Clearly Wal-Mart and other discount stores are drawing
shoppers across all age groups, income levels, and other
demographics," he said.
Drug stores followed discount stores in popularity, with 53.3
percent of the shoppers interviewed saying they made purchases
in drug stores in April. Home improvement stores, retailers of
appliances, electronics and computers, and national department
stores like Sears and JC Penney rounded out the top five most
popular retail categories.
The Consumer Mind Reader survey was conducted May 9-11, 2005
and included 1,000 telephone interviews with consumers
nationwide. The margin of error is +/- 4.3 percent.
A listing of the top 10 most popular retail stores for April,
2005 follows.
